متن کاملNotes on Nonrepetitive Graph Colouring
A vertex colouring of a graph is nonrepetitive on paths if there is no path v1, v2, . . . , v2t such that vi and vt+i receive the same colour for all i = 1, 2, . . . , t. We determine the maximum density of a graph that admits a k-colouring that is nonrepetitive on paths. متن کاملOn Harmonious Colouring of Trees
Let G be a simple graph and (G) denote the maximum degree of G. A harmonious colouring of G is a proper vertex colouring such that each pair of colours appears together on at most one edge. The harmonious chromatic number h(G) is the least number of colours in such a colouring.
